The “Smart Manufacturing Joint Lab (SMJL) Phase 2 Launch Ceremony”, meticulously planned and executed by Ooffle, was successfully held in Singapore on October 3, 2025.

Jointly organized by the Agency for Science, Technology and Research (A*STAR), Rolls-Royce, and the Singapore Aero Engine Services Limited (SAESL), the event marked a significant milestone in strengthening strategic collaboration across aerospace manufacturing and Maintenance, Repair and Overhaul (MRO) technologies.

The launch unveiled four major joint R&D projects with a total investment of SGD 55 million, including nearly SGD 34 million dedicated to SMJL Phase 2.
This initiative focuses on additive manufacturing, intelligent inspection, and AI-driven process optimization, expected to increase Rolls-Royce’s Singapore fan blade production capacity by 30%, boost SAESL’s repair capacity by 40% by 2028, and create 500 high-skilled jobs — reinforcing Singapore’s position as a global leader in aerospace manufacturing and maintenance.

Stage and LED System

The main stage featured a large platform finished with black carpeting and dual side stairways.
Despite a 3.5m ceiling height constraint, Ooffle achieved structural precision and visual balance through expert spatial planning.

The backdrop comprised a main LED screen and two side screens, powered by the Magnimage V6 controller, Vmix playback system, and dual laptops, delivering bright visuals, seamless transitions, and real-time synchronization.

Stage Setup and Décor

The stage included a black lectern with branded signage and two signing tables with skirting.
A 7.5m greenery installation adorned the stage front, blending natural elements with technological aesthetics — reflecting the scientific spirit of the SMJL initiative.

Lighting and Audio System

The lighting system featured an Avolite console, front lights, 400W moving heads, and dual lighting stands, enabling precise control of stage ambience and intensity.
The audio setup included main speakers, subwoofers, stage monitors, wireless microphones, gooseneck mics, and intercom units, operated by professional sound engineers.
A multi-zone sound configuration ensured synchronized and clear transmission across multiple exhibit areas.
